Output caaaefb4b3063d9a878d87b8a1ffb474d4ddf75ff77ca0789e46c8d359318a36:1

value
20409706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d85bb3aae9d5085a0ef4c37a97b7d9f63744359 OP_EQUAL
address
35qiXzckKCSx3vLfVR6BvsMvSk17tNwaJB
transaction
caaaefb4b3063d9a878d87b8a1ffb474d4ddf75ff77ca0789e46c8d359318a36
spent
true